I migliori strumenti gratuiti di monitoraggio della larghezza di banda: i primi 5 messi alla prova

click fraud protection

Tutti desideriamo che la nostra rete abbia una larghezza di banda infinita, ma sfortunatamente non lo fanno mai. In effetti, sebbene le cose siano migliorate su questo fronte negli ultimi anni, la congestione è ancora il problema più grande di ogni rete. La congestione si verifica quando la larghezza di banda effettiva si avvicina o supera quella disponibile. Come regola generale, gli amministratori di rete cercano di mantenere l'utilizzo della larghezza di banda al di sotto del 70% della larghezza di banda disponibile. Quindi, su un'interfaccia da 1 Gb / s, non dovrebbero mai esserci più di 700 Mb / s. Il modo migliore per evitare che ciò accada è tenere d'occhio il traffico di rete effettivo. Questo viene fatto con uno strumento di monitoraggio della larghezza di banda e questo è ciò di cui parla oggi l'articolo. Stiamo rivelando i cinque migliori strumenti gratuiti di monitoraggio della larghezza di banda che siamo riusciti a trovare.

Ma prima di parlarti degli strumenti reali che abbiamo trovato, ci fermeremo brevemente e spiegheremo i diversi metodi che possono essere utilizzati per monitorare la larghezza di banda, come vedrai, ce ne sono principalmente tre. E una volta che avrai una migliore comprensione di come viene effettuato il monitoraggio, sarai in una posizione migliore per apprezzare appieno le diverse caratteristiche degli strumenti che stiamo per introdurre.

instagram viewer

Perché monitorare la larghezza di banda

Grafico di utilizzo della larghezza di banda

Come spiegato in precedenza, la congestione è il nemico numero uno delle reti. Puoi pensare a una rete come a un'autostrada in cui la congestione è simile agli ingorghi. Ma a differenza del traffico automobilistico che si può facilmente vedere, il traffico di rete avviene all'interno di cavi, switch e router dove rimane invisibile. È qui che gli strumenti di monitoraggio della larghezza di banda della rete possono tornare utili. Offrono agli amministratori di rete la visibilità di cui hanno bisogno per mantenere le cose senza intoppi. Dopotutto, non è quello che ci si aspettava da loro?

Un altro motivo per monitorare l'utilizzo della larghezza di banda della rete è la pianificazione della capacità. È innegabile che utenti, sistemi e processi tenderanno ad aumentare il loro utilizzo delle reti nel tempo. Indipendentemente dalla larghezza di banda dei tuoi circuiti attuali, è probabile che alla fine debbano essere aumentati. E monitorando l'utilizzo della larghezza di banda, saprai sempre quale circuito deve essere aggiornato e quando.

Com'è fatto?

Esistono diversi modi che possono essere citati in giudizio per monitorare l'utilizzo della larghezza di banda della rete. Il primo è acquisire pacchetti in un determinato punto della rete. È inoltre possibile utilizzare SNMP per eseguire il polling dei dispositivi per le statistiche dell'interfaccia e, infine, è possibile disporre di dispositivi che supportano l'invio di NetFlow di informazioni S-Flow. Esaminiamo brevemente come funzionano tutti.

Acquisizione pacchetti

L'acquisizione di pacchetti era il modo numero uno per analizzare il traffico di rete. Non più così tanto. È ancora molto utilizzato per individuare specifici problemi di rete, ma raramente viene utilizzato per il monitoraggio della larghezza di banda. Con l'acquisizione di pacchetti, ogni pacchetto di dati in entrata e in uscita dall'interfaccia di un dispositivo specifico viene acquisito e decodificato.

Dal momento che quando si controlla la larghezza di banda, non siamo veramente interessati al contenuto di ciascun pacchetto ma solo alle sue dimensioni, questo metodo è un enorme sovraccarico ed è per questo che è caduto in disgrazia.

SNMP

Simple Network Management Protocol (o SNMP) è un protocollo enorme e molto complesso che può essere utilizzato per monitorare, configurare e modificare in remoto molti tipi diversi di apparecchiature di rete. L'unica cosa semplice è il suo nome. L'implementazione è un compito complesso. Ciascun dispositivo abilitato SNMP rende disponibile un determinato numero di parametri. Alcuni sono di sola lettura, altri sono modificabili.

Di particolare interesse per quanto riguarda il monitoraggio della larghezza di banda sono due valori. Di solito sono disponibili per ciascuna interfaccia di rete di un dispositivo abilitato SNMP. I due valori sono byte in e byte in uscita. Leggendo periodicamente questi valori, è possibile calcolare il numero di byte per unità di tempo, che è esattamente la larghezza di banda.

Alcuni altri parametri SNMP possono essere interessanti in un contesto di monitoraggio della rete. In particolare, esiste il numero di errori di input e output dell'interfaccia. Simile a ciò che viene fatto con i byte in e out, questi valori possono essere utilizzati per calcolare il numero di errori al secondo, una cifra che ti dice molto sulla salute generale di un collegamento di rete.

Analisi del flusso

Sviluppato originariamente da Cisco Systems, NetFlow è, come suggerisce il nome, un sistema di analisi del flusso di rete. I dispositivi che supportano NetFlow — o sono più cugini come J-flow o S-flow — raccolgono informazioni su ciascun flusso di dati - da qui il nome - che poi hanno inviato a un analizzatore NetFlow.

Per ulteriori informazioni sull'analisi del flusso, è possibile leggere di più nel nostro Articolo su collezionisti e analizzatori NetFlow.

I migliori strumenti gratuiti di monitoraggio della larghezza di banda

Ora che conosciamo i diversi modi in cui possiamo monitorare il traffico, diamo un'occhiata a cinque dei migliori strumenti gratuiti di monitoraggio della larghezza di banda che puoi trovare. Essendo strumenti gratuiti, alcuni potrebbero essere limitati nella loro capacità e alcuni - in realtà, la maggior parte di essi - potrebbero richiedere un bel po 'di configurazione per farli funzionare a tuo piacimento.

Ogni amministratore di rete dovrebbe conoscere SolarWinds. La società con sede negli Stati Uniti ha creato ottimi strumenti di amministrazione della rete per circa 20 anni. La società ha acquisito un'eccellente reputazione per la creazione di strumenti gratuiti così fantastici che sono distribuiti in modo semplice. SolarWinds produce anche numerosi strumenti commerciali tra i migliori sul mercato. Il suo prodotto di punta, il Network Performance Monitor è una soluzione di monitoraggio completa che può essere adattata a reti di qualsiasi dimensione.

Uno dei migliori strumenti gratuiti di SolarWinds e la nostra scelta numero uno è il Monitor della larghezza di banda in tempo reale di SolarWinds. Il software, che funziona su Microsoft Windows, utilizza SNMP per eseguire il polling di più dispositivi di rete e ottenere statistiche sul traffico dalle loro diverse interfacce. I risultati sono mostrati visivamente su grafici che rappresentano le statistiche di utilizzo di ciascuna interfaccia.

Monitor della larghezza di banda in tempo reale di SolarWinds - Configurazione del dispositivo

La configurazione dello strumento è una semplice questione di fornire l'indirizzo IP di un dispositivo o il nome host e i parametri SNMP come la versione SNMP e la stringa della comunità. Il monitor della larghezza di banda in tempo reale visualizza quindi un elenco di interfacce disponibili sul dispositivo scelto con anche alcuni dati di base su di essi.

Monitor della larghezza di banda in tempo reale di SolarWinds - Selezione dell'interfaccia

La selezione di un'interfaccia specifica facendo clic su di essa rivela un grafico che mostra l'utilizzo della larghezza di banda in entrata e in uscita sull'interfaccia selezionata. È inoltre possibile impostare le soglie di avviso in modo che vengano notificate ogni volta che l'utilizzo supera un limite predefinito su qualsiasi interfaccia

Grafico dell'interfaccia di monitoraggio della larghezza di banda in tempo reale di SolarWinds

Ci sono alcune limitazioni a questo strumento gratuito. Ad esempio, è possibile configurare un solo dispositivo alla volta. Inoltre, la cronologia di utilizzo viene conservata solo per 60 minuti. Ciò rende lo strumento una grande risorsa per la risoluzione dei problemi, ma probabilmente non per il rilevamento dell'evoluzione dell'utilizzo a lungo termine. Per un pacchetto più completo, è possibile acquistare il pacchetto analizzatore di larghezza di banda SolarWinds.

Il monitor della larghezza di banda in tempo reale di SolarWinds è distribuito in bundle insieme all'analizzatore di rete SolarWinds, un altro ottimo strumento gratuito che è possibile utilizzare per monitorare i dispositivi abilitati NetFlow. Questo strumento ti consentirà di eseguire il drill down tramite la conversazione, l'applicazione, gli endpoint o il protocollo che il monitor della larghezza di banda in tempo reale non avrà.

È possibile ottenere il pacchetto sia con il Monitor della larghezza di banda in tempo reale gratuito sia con l'analizzatore di rete visitando https://www.solarwinds.com/free-tools/network-analyzer-bandwidth-monitoring-bundle

2. ManageEngine Software di monitoraggio della larghezza di banda SNMP

ManageEngine è auto-descritto come una società che "ha soluzioni complete e semplici anche per i più difficili problemi di gestione IT, da mantenere la tua azienda sicura per garantire un'alta disponibilità per rendere felici i tuoi utenti. " Questa è una dichiarazione audace, ma descrive abbastanza l'azienda bene. ManageEngine è noto per i suoi strumenti di alta qualità, inclusi diversi strumenti volti a monitorare diversi aspetti delle reti.

E proprio come SolarWinds, ManageEngine è anche famoso per i suoi strumenti gratuiti. Di particolare interesse nel contesto di questo articolo è il Software di monitoraggio della larghezza di banda SNMP. Viene offerto come parte del pacchetto gratuito OpUtils di ManageEngine, un enorme pacchetto di circa 16 utility di gestione della rete. Funziona su Windows e Linux e la versione gratuita consente di monitorare fino a 10 dispositivi e le loro interfacce.

ManageEngine Network Monitor

L'impostazione dello strumento, come quasi sempre, richiede diversi passaggi. Prima devi specificare una sottorete da scansionare e alcuni parametri SNMP da usare. Lo strumento rileverà quindi i dispositivi sulla sottorete specificata. Una volta rilevati i dispositivi, puoi visualizzare gli stati della loro interfaccia dalla scheda dello spazio pubblicitario. È inoltre possibile visualizzare grafici della velocità della rete e dell'utilizzo della larghezza di banda.

Gestisci allarmi motore

Per ciascuna interfaccia, è possibile generare report sull'utilizzo della larghezza di banda nelle ultime 12 ore a un mese. Inoltre, è possibile impostare soglie di avviso ed essere avvisati via e-mail o SMS ogni volta che vengono raggiunti.

Il software di monitoraggio della larghezza di banda SNMP ManageEngine è l'ideale se la tua rete è piccola con non più di 10 dispositivi. Se gestisci una rete più grande, ManageEngine ha anche una versione a pagamento senza limiti di dispositivo che potresti voler provare. Per semplificare, ManageEngine offre una versione di valutazione gratuita di 30 giorni del suo software OpsUtil completo. In effetti, la versione gratuita viene prima installata come versione di prova di 30 giorni e ripristina le funzionalità limitate al termine del periodo di prova.

3. MRTG

Il Grauter di traffico multi routero MRTG, come viene comunemente chiamato, è un sistema di monitoraggio e rappresentazione della larghezza di banda totalmente gratuito e open source. È in circolazione dal 1995 ma è ancora in uso diffuso, nonostante l'ultima versione abbia già cinque anni.

MRTG è sviluppato dallo sviluppatore svizzero Tobi Oetiker. È scritto principalmente in Perl e il codice sorgente completo è facilmente disponibile, consentendo a chiunque di personalizzarlo in base alle proprie esigenze specifiche. Alcune parti del sistema sono scritte in C per un'esecuzione più rapida. È disponibile per Windows e Linux. Sebbene la configurazione e la configurazione iniziale siano in qualche modo più complicate di quelle che potresti sperimentare con altri sistemi di monitoraggio, la documentazione è prontamente disponibile.

https://oss.oetiker.ch/mrtg/index.en.html
Un tipico grafico MRTG che mostra l'utilizzo della larghezza di banda

I componenti principali di MRTG sono uno script Perl che legge i dati SNMP dai dispositivi di destinazione e un programma C. che prende i dati, li archivia in un database round robin e crea pagine Web con l'utilizzo della larghezza di banda grafici. In realtà, MRTG non monitora solo la larghezza di banda. Può anche monitorare, registrare e rappresentare graficamente qualsiasi parametro SNMP.

Pagina dell'indice MTRG

L'installazione di MRTG è un processo in più passaggi e richiede prima l'installazione e la configurazione di Perl. Inoltre, eseguire MRTG come servizio di Windows, sicuramente qualcosa che si vorrebbe, richiede alcune ulteriori manipolazioni, tra cui alcune modifiche al registro. Una volta installato, si configura il software modificando il suo file di configurazione. Questo è probabilmente qualcosa che ogni amministratore di Linux potrebbe avere familiarità, ma le persone con solo competenze di Windows potrebbero sperimentare una curva di apprendimento più ripida.

Puoi scaricare l'ultima versione di MRTG direttamente dal sito web dello sviluppatore. È disponibile come file .zip per Windows o tarball per Linux. Al momento della stesura di questo documento, l'ultima versione stabile è la 2.17.4.

Sebbene MRTG potrebbe non essere il sistema di monitoraggio più intuitivo, è probabilmente il più flessibile. Essere scritti in Perl significa che praticamente chiunque può modificarlo e adattarlo alle sue esatte esigenze. E il fatto che sia il primo sistema di monitoraggio e che sia ancora in circolazione è una testimonianza del suo valore.

4. cactus

cactus può essere visto come un lontano cugino di MRTG. E se guardi uno dei grafici di Cati, scoprirai che la somiglianza con quella di MRTG è sorprendente. Non è una sorpresa dato che Cactus è basato su RRDTools, che è un diretto discendente di Cactus.

Cacti è flessibile e versatile come MRTG ma è un prodotto più raffinato con una grande interfaccia utente basata sul web che rende la configurazione molto semplice e intuitiva. è un pacchetto grafico completo di rete che utilizza RRDTool, uno strumento per la registrazione e la rappresentazione dei dati di Tobi Oetiker, che ci ha portato anche MRTG. Cactus comprende un poller veloce, modelli grafici avanzati, diversi metodi di acquisizione e funzionalità di gestione degli utenti. È altrettanto utile per le installazioni LAN più piccole come lo è per le reti complesse con migliaia di dispositivi su più siti.

Schermata di cactus

Per capire meglio i cactus, parliamo di RRDtool per un momento. Secondo il suo sviluppatore “RRDtool è lo standard industriale OpenSource, il sistema di registrazione e rappresentazione grafica dei dati ad alte prestazioni per i dati delle serie storiche. RRDtool può essere facilmente integrato in script shell, applicazioni Perl, Python, Ruby, Lua o Tcl. " RRDtool è un discendente diretto di MRTG.

In breve, Cacti è un frontend per RRDTool. Memorizza i dati necessari per creare grafici e popolarli con i dati in un database MySQL. È interamente scritto in PHP guidato. Cactus ti consente di conservare grafici, fonti di dati e archivi Round Robin in un database e gestisce anche la raccolta dei dati. E c'è il supporto SNMP per coloro che sono abituati a creare grafici di traffico con MRTG. È un dato di fatto, molti utenti Cacti sono ex utenti MRTG ed è così che sono entrato in Cacti quando avevo bisogno di sostituire MRTG con qualcosa che era più facile da installare e utilizzare. I cactus possono essere scaricati direttamente dal sito web dell'azienda

5. PRTG

Ultimo ma certamente non meno importante è il Paessler Router Traffic Grapher o PRTG. La società tedesca offre un'ottima soluzione di monitoraggio, in qualche modo simile a Cacti o MRTG: è no mi chiedo che l'acronimo del prodotto sia così simile a quello di MRTG, ma con un aspetto più lucido e professionale esso.

Secondo Paessler, puoi impostare PRTG ed essere attivo e funzionante in un paio di minuti. La nostra esperienza dimostra che potrebbe volerci un po 'più di tempo per configurarlo a tuo piacimento e monitorare tutti i tuoi dispositivi, ma dobbiamo ammettere che la configurazione del prodotto è stata eccezionalmente semplice Esperienza.

PRTG

Per quanto riguarda le funzionalità, PRTG è un prodotto impressionante. Per cominciare, il prodotto viene fornito con diverse interfacce utente. Esiste una console aziendale Windows nativa, un'interfaccia web basata su Ajax e app mobili per Android e iOS. E la diversa interfaccia sfrutta appieno le capacità di ciascun dispositivo. Ad esempio, PRTG ti consente di stampare etichette con codice QR che puoi apporre sui tuoi dispositivi. Quindi, la scansione del codice dall'app mobile ti porterà rapidamente ai grafici del dispositivo.

E parlando di grafici, PRTG non lascia nulla a desiderare. Può non solo monitorare e rappresentare graficamente l'utilizzo della larghezza di banda, ma anche molti altri parametri usando SNMP, WMI, NetFlow e Sflow. Ha anche alcuni report sorprendenti che possono essere visualizzati come HTML o PDF o esportati in CSV o XML per essere elaborati esternamente. I report possono essere eseguiti su richiesta o pianificati per l'esecuzione automatica.

Esempio di report PRTG

Il Sito web Paessler consente di scaricare due diverse versioni di PRTG. Puoi scegliere la versione gratuita della versione di prova gratuita di 30 giorni. Il primo ti limiterà a monitorare fino a 100 sensori. Nel linguaggio PRTG, un sensore è ogni parametro che si desidera monitorare. Ad esempio, il monitoraggio della larghezza di banda su ciascuna porta di uno switch a 48 porte richiederà 48 sensori. E se vuoi anche monitorare la CPU e i carichi di memoria dello switch, avrai bisogno di altri due sensori. Come puoi vedere, possono sommarsi rapidamente.

Quale dovrei usare?

Questa è la risposta che tutti sembrano cercare, ma è una delle domande più difficili a cui rispondere. Ci piace molto il monitor della larghezza di banda in tempo reale di SolarWinds. Comprende molte funzionalità, funziona molto bene e non è complicato da configurare. È anche un'ottima introduzione ad altri strumenti disponibili da SolarWinds. Dopo averne provato uno, ti consigliamo di dare un'occhiata di più. Per quanto riguarda gli altri prodotti della nostra lista, sono anche ottimi prodotti e sceglierne uno sarà spesso una questione di gusti personali. Per una soluzione totalmente gratuita in grado di adattarsi a qualsiasi dimensione di installazione, MRTG e Cati sono difficili da battere. Per un aspetto più raffinato e se gestisci una rete più piccola, anche le offerte di ManageEngine e Paessler sono fantastiche.

In conclusione

I sistemi di monitoraggio della larghezza di banda sono tra gli strumenti più utili per un amministratore di rete. E con molte opzioni gratuite disponibili, non c'è motivo di non iniziare a usarle subito. Qualunque di questi sistemi che decidi di provare, otterrai una preziosa visione di ciò che sta accadendo sulla tua rete. Molti di questi strumenti fanno alcuni sforzi per farli funzionare, ma possiamo assicurarvi che saranno molto probabilmente sforzi ben ricompensati.

watch instagram story